Thailand is a fantastic destination, and with a week to explore, you can really soak in the culture, food, and stunning landscapes. Since you’re traveling with a friend on a budget, I suggest focusing on two amazing places: Bangkok and Chiang Mai. They offer a great mix of urban excitement and cultural experiences without breaking the bank. Let’s dive into your 7-day itinerary!

## Day 1: Arrival in Bangkok

  • Morning: Arrive in Bangkok! Check into a budget-friendly hostel or guesthouse in the Khao San Road area, which is popular among backpackers.
  • Afternoon: Grab some street food for lunch (try Pad Thai or Som Tum) and then head to the Grand Palace. It’s a must-see, and the architecture is stunning!
  • Evening: Explore the vibrant streets of Khao San Road. Enjoy some live music, and don’t forget to try a bucket cocktail or some local beer!

## Day 2: Bangkok Exploration

  • Morning: Visit Wat Pho to see the famous Reclining Buddha. It’s a short walk from the Grand Palace.
  • Afternoon: Take a boat ride on the Chao Phraya River to Wat Arun (Temple of Dawn). The views are breathtaking! Have lunch at a riverside café.
  • Evening: Head to Chinatown for dinner. The street food here is legendary! Try some grilled seafood or dim sum.

## Day 4: Travel to Chiang Mai

  • Morning: Take a budget flight or an overnight bus to Chiang Mai. The bus is cheaper, but the flight saves time!
  • Afternoon: Check into a guesthouse in the Old City. After settling in, explore the local temples like Wat Phra Singh.
  • Evening: Enjoy a traditional Khantoke dinner, where you can sample various Northern Thai dishes while watching cultural performances.

## Day 5: Chiang Mai Adventures

  • Morning: Take a day trip to Doi Suthep. The temple on the mountain offers stunning views of the city. You can hike or take a songthaew (shared taxi).
  • Afternoon: Visit the Hmong Village nearby to learn about the local culture. Grab lunch at a local eatery.
  • Evening: Back in Chiang Mai, explore the Sunday Walking Street Market (if it’s Sunday) for crafts, food, and live music.

## Day 6: Nature and Elephants

  • Morning: Spend the day at an ethical elephant sanctuary. Many offer half-day programs where you can feed and bathe the elephants. It’s a memorable experience!
  • Afternoon: Enjoy a simple lunch at the sanctuary or head back to the city for some local food.
  • Evening: Relax at a local café or bar. Try some local craft beers or a refreshing Thai iced tea.

## Day 7: Last Day in Chiang Mai

  • Morning: Visit the Chiang Mai Night Safari or take a cooking class to learn how to make your favorite Thai dishes.
  • Afternoon: Spend your last few hours shopping for souvenirs at local markets or relaxing at a café.
  • Evening: Head to the airport or bus station for your journey back home, filled with amazing memories!

Tips for Budget Travel:

  • Use public transport like buses and tuk-tuks to save money.
  • Eat street food; it’s delicious and affordable!
  • Look for free walking tours in both cities to learn more about the culture without spending much.
